28、 first edition of this standard as an informative annex; however, should its use become more generally accepted then the status of the information would need to be reviewed. 1 Scope This European Standard specifies the requirements related to safety for hoist chain, Grade T (type T quenched and temp

29、ered and types DAT and DT case hardened), for use in serial chain hoists manual and power driven. Type DAT and type DT hoist chains possess surface hardnesses greater than core hardness and are used for power driven chain hoists to offer greater resistance to wear. Type DT hoist chain differs from D

30、AT hoist chain in having higher surface hardness and/or greater case depth to optimise wear resistance. The standard is applicable to electrically welded round steel short link hoist chains conforming to EN 818-1. The range of nominal size of hoist chains covered by this European Standard is from 4

31、mm to 22 mm. 37、818-1 apply. 5 DINEN8187:200807 EN8187:2002+A1:2008(E)4 Hazards The release of a load due to failure of hoist chain puts at risk either directly or indirectly the safety or health of those persons within the danger zone of lifting equipment. In order to provide the necessary strength and durability

38、of hoist chain, this European Standard lays down requirements for the design, selection of materials of construction and testing to ensure that specified levels of performance are met. Fatigue failure has not been identified as a hazard for type T chain when hoist chain selected according to annex B

39、 and having the specified levels of performance and design given in this European Standard is used in serial hoists. Fatigue failure has been identified as a hazard for hoist chains types DAT and DT used in power driven hoists. Therefore this European Standard specifies levels of design and performa

40、nce, with particular reference to fatigue resistance. Since failure can be caused by the incorrect choice of grades and specification of lifting hoist chain this European Standard also gives the requirements for marking and the manufacturers certificate. Dimensional incompatibility between the hoist

41、 chain and mating parts of the hoist (chain wheel, chain guide and loading device) may lead to premature failure and this European Standard contains dimensional requirements for correct assembly and fit. 43、inadequacy of strength 4.1.2.3 4.1.2.4 4.2.4 6 1.7.3 4.3.1 7 1.5 (Types DAT, DT only) - 5.5.6 Fatigue failure and 6.2.7 6 EN8187:2002+A1:2008(E) DINEN8187:2008075 Safety requirements 5.1 General The hoist chains shall conform to the requirements of EN 818-1. 5.2 Dimensions 5.2.1 General A selection

44、of nominal sizes and dimensions is given in 5.2.2 and 5.2.4. Other nominal sizes may be used, provided that nominal sizes shall not exceed the range specified in 5.2.2 and that the dimensions and tolerances are calculated in accordance with annex A. Whilst the nominal link pitch p nis based upon 3 d

45、 n(where d nis the nominal size of the hoist chains) this may be varied but shall not exceed the limits 2,6 d nto 3,2 d n . The nominal link pitch p nshall be subject to the tolerances specified in annex A. NOTE Compatibility between the hoist chain and the mating parts of the hoist requires agreeme

46、nt on the nominal size and dimensions and on the distribution of tolerances between the chain manufacturer and the hoist manufacturer. 5.2.2 Nominal size d nThe nominal size shall not be below 4 mm or above 22 mm, a selection of nominal sizes is listed in Table 2. 5.2.3 Tolerances on material diamet

47、er The tolerances on material diameter for the selected nominal sizes shall be as listed in Table 2. These and all other nominal size material diameter tolerances shall be calculated in accordance with A.1. 5.2.4 Pitch and widths The dimensions and tolerances of the 3 d npitch and the width for the

48、selected nominal sizes shall be as listed in Table 2. The dimensions and tolerances of the pitch and width shall be calculated in accordance with A.1. These dimensions and tolerances and all other nominal size and pitch ranges and tolerances of multiple pitch lengths, shall be calculated in accordance with A.1.
